“机器人医生”上岗做艾灸 黑科技引爆国际采购热潮
Nan Fang Du Shi Bao· 2025-10-15 23:12
Core Insights - The 138th Canton Fair has introduced a Smart Medical Zone, showcasing advanced medical products and technologies from 47 companies, including surgical robots and wearable devices [8] - The Service Robot Zone features 46 leading enterprises, displaying various robots such as humanoid robots and robotic dogs, attracting a large number of domestic and international buyers [8] Smart Medical Technology - The Nova collaborative robot from Shenzhen Yuejiang Technology Co., Ltd. is highlighted for its intelligent moxibustion device, which mimics expert techniques with high precision, offering personalized therapy experiences [10][11] - Yuanhua Intelligent Technology's Kuntuo® orthopedic surgical robot has successfully completed 5,000 clinical surgeries across over 100 hospitals, improving accuracy by 34% compared to traditional methods and reducing postoperative medication by 30% [11] Service Robots - Shenzhen Infinite Power Development Co., Ltd. aims to sell 1.8 million robotic vacuum cleaners overseas this year, up from 1.5 million last year, focusing on high-end market segments [12] - Zhihui Technology's Allybot-C2 Pro commercial cleaning robot integrates multiple cleaning functions and is designed for high efficiency, with a significant increase in overseas orders expected [13][14] Wearable Robotics - Tai Xi Intelligent Technology's wearable exoskeleton has gained attention for its ability to enhance user efficiency and reduce energy consumption by approximately 30%, particularly beneficial for the elderly [15] - The exoskeleton's features include a comfortable design and a battery life of up to 8 hours, making it suitable for various users, including those with mobility challenges [15] Market Trends and International Response - The demand for service robots is growing, with international buyers expressing interest in the innovative technologies showcased at the fair, indicating a shift in global manufacturing dynamics [17] - Buyers from Europe and North America are particularly interested in the cost-saving potential of these technologies in sectors like hospitality, where labor shortages are prevalent [17][18]
